CAPABILITY Ideal for combined cycle, onshore and offshore power generation, mechanical drive, and cogeneration VERSATILITY Accommodates a wide variety of fuels, including coke oven gas, naphtha, propane, diesel, ethanol, and LNG SUSTAINABILITY Multiple technology options available to lower NOx and other emissions concerns With more than 2,400 units sold and more than 79 million operating hours, GE’s LM2500 is the top-selling gas turbine globally. Ideal for CHP applications between 20 to 40 MW, the LM2500’s greater than 85 percent efficiency helps reduce operating costs, plant emissions, and reliance on the local grid. A lightweight and compact modular design complements the universal packaging, which improves accessibility for maintenance. The LM2500 delivers power with reliability greater than 99 percent and availability greater than 98 percent. gepower.com © 2018 General Electric Company. All rights reserved. GEA32937A (11/2018)
